What is the standard form of a linear equation?

Back

The standard form of a linear equation is Ax + By = C, where A, B, and C are integers, and A should be non-negative.

How do you convert the equation y = mx + b to standard form?

Back

To convert y = mx + b to standard form, rearrange it to the form Ax + By = C by moving all terms involving variables to one side.

What does the slope (m) represent in the equation y = mx + b?

Back

The slope (m) represents the rate of change of y with respect to x, indicating how steep the line is.

What does the y-intercept (b) represent in the equation y = mx + b?

Back

The y-intercept (b) is the point where the line crosses the y-axis, indicating the value of y when x = 0.

How can you find the x-intercept of a linear equation?

Back

To find the x-intercept, set y = 0 in the equation and solve for x.

What is the x-intercept of the equation x + y = 4?

Back

The x-intercept is 4, found by setting y = 0: x + 0 = 4.

What is the y-intercept of the equation x + y = 4?

Back

The y-intercept is 4, found by setting x = 0: 0 + y = 4.
